грешка при компилиране в android, когато заменя нискокачествено png изображение с HD png изображение

Нов съм в android. Получавам тази странна грешка, че използвах нискокачествено png изображение като фон за стартовия екран, но сега получих HD изображение на същото и замених това нискокачествено изображение с HD изображение. Но получавам тази странна грешка при изграждането.

Error:Error: com.android.ide.common.process.ProcessException: org.gradle.process.internal.ExecException: Process 'command 'C:\Users\Mubashir.gul\AppData\Local\Android\sdk\build-tools\21.1.2\aapt.exe'' finished with non-zero exit value 42
Error:Execution failed for task ':app:mergeDebugResources'.
> C:\Users\Mubashir.gul\AndroidStudioProjects\Highrise\app\src\main\res\mipmap-mdpi\logo.png: Error: com.android.ide.common.process.ProcessException: org.gradle.process.internal.ExecException: Process 'command 'C:\Users\Mubashir.gul\AppData\Local\Android\sdk\build-tools\21.1.2\aapt.exe'' finished with non-zero exit value 42

Дори ако не използвам това изображение в никоя от дейностите и просто поставя това изображение в папката на моя проект като drawable, това води до горната грешка.


person killer    schedule 05.05.2015    source източник
comment
вместо да използвате HD изображение.. опитайте да използвате друго изображение.. и моля, проверете дали ще бъде повдигнато отново същото?   -  person Vaishali Sutariya    schedule 05.05.2015
comment
Работи добре, но ако използвам изображение с ниско качество, се размазва   -  person killer    schedule 05.05.2015
comment
след това използвайте изображение с 9 корекции, това ще реши проблема ви със замъгляването на изображението   -  person Vaishali Sutariya    schedule 05.05.2015


Отговори (1)


Опитайте да използвате най-новата версия на build tools. ще го получите от sdk manager. Опитайте и ме уведомете за напредъка. Сблъсквате се с подобен проблем като този.

Ако използвате изображения за задаване на фоново изображение в дейността, тогава се препоръчва изображението да е от папка drawable. Mipmap се използва само за икони. Така че опитайте да го използвате от drawables отколкото mipmap. Надявам се да помогне.

person Roon13    schedule 05.05.2015